South Bay Lakers' Win Streak Highlights G League's NBA Talent Launchpad
South Bay Lakers shatter franchise record with eleventh straight win, led by rookie stars Adou Thiero, Bronny James, Drew Timme, and Nick Smith Junior. The G League has transformed into a legitimate NBA talent pipeline, with teams like Ignite producing lottery picks and two-way contracts blossoming into full-time NBA deals. Lakers head coach JJ Redick commends LeBron James team-first mentality, as the veteran star defers to younger players like Austin Reaves, signaling a potential shift in the Lakers approach to player development.
